Loaded Potato Skins: Price and Portion

TGI Fridays’ Loaded Potato Skins typically cost around $10–$13 and come as a shareable order of six crisp potato halves. You’ll get baked potato shells topped with melted cheese, bacon, and green onions, usually served with sour cream for dipping.
TGI Fridays’ Loaded Potato Skins cost around $10–$13 and include six cheesy, bacon-topped potato halves with sour cream.
The loaded potato skins offer a practical choice when you want a starter to split without ordering several appetizers.
Their portion size works well for two or three people, especially if everyone takes one or two halves before the meal arrives.
If you’re dining alone, the six-piece order can serve as a filling snack or a light meal, though you may want an additional side for more substance.

Signature Whiskey-Glazed Burger: Price and Review
At roughly $14–$17, the Signature Whiskey-Glazed Burger gives you a juicy beef patty topped with bacon, cheddar, crispy onions, lettuce, tomato, and TGI Fridays’ sweet-and-savory whiskey glaze. You get a satisfying mix of smoky, tangy, and sweet flavors, while the toasted bun keeps every bite together.
The whiskey glaze adds a polished finish without overwhelming the beef, and the varied burger toppings create welcome contrast in texture.

TGI Fridays Cheeseburger: Cost and Value
Priced at roughly $13–$16, TGI Fridays’ Cheeseburger offers solid value when you want a classic, filling meal without the whiskey glaze or heavier toppings. You get a seasoned beef patty, melted cheese, lettuce, tomato, onion, and pickles on a toasted bun, creating a dependable combination that satisfies without feeling excessive.
The price makes sense if you’re seeking a complete entrée rather than a small snack. Fries typically round out the plate, so you won’t need to add another side to feel full.

Brownie Obsession: Dessert Price and Serving Size
TGI Fridays’ Brownie Obsession typically costs around $9 and comes as a shareable dessert, though exact prices and portions may vary by location. You’ll get a warm, fudgy brownie topped with vanilla ice cream, chocolate ganache, and often caramel sauce.
The serving size suits two people comfortably, although you may want it all to yourself after a savory meal.
